What Does “Rent Burdened” Mean? How Much Rent Is Too Much

Learn the official definition (spending 30% or more of your gross income on housing) and how to calculate your exact rent-to-income ratio. This guide offers expert tips on factoring in total housing costs (including utilities and fees) and budgeting accurately to avoid unnecessary financial strain.

Cheapest Available Fulton Apartments for Rent and Nearby

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in Fulton, TX is a Studio unit found at Studio 44 Apartments in the North Beach neighborhood priced from $725. Rockport Oaks Garden Apartments has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$785. Here is today’s list of the most affordable Fulton apartments for rent:

Quick Rent Budget Calculator

How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
